The MERN stack (MongoDB, Express.js, React, Node.js) is ideal for building medicine delivery applications due to several reasons: Full-Stack JavaScript: Using JavaScript across the entire stack simplifies development and allows for seamless communication between the client and server. Real-Time Data Handling: Node.js enables efficient handling of real-time data, crucial for features like order tracking and notifications. Responsive User Interfaces: React allows for the creation of dynamic and responsive user interfaces, enhancing user experience for browsing medicines and placing orders. Scalability: MongoDB's NoSQL database is highly scalable, accommodating growing data needs as the application expands. Community Support: A strong community offers resources, documentation, and support, making it easier to troubleshoot issues and implement best practices.
Building a medicine delivery app requires careful planning and execution. Here’s a detailed and structured approach to guide you through the process: 1. Conduct Thorough Market Research Identify Competitors: Analyze existing medicine delivery apps to understand their strengths and weaknesses. Understand User Needs: Conduct surveys and interviews to gather insights on what features users desire. 2. Define Core Features User Features: Registration & Login: Secure user accounts using email or social media. Medicine Search: Easy navigation with search filters for brands, categories, and availability. Cart & Checkout: Simple cart management and a streamlined checkout process. Prescription Upload: Option for users to upload prescriptions directly. Order Tracking: Real-time tracking of delivery status. Payment Options: Multiple payment gateways (credit/debit cards, wallets). Admin Features: Dashboard: Comprehensive view of sales, inventory, and user activity. Inventory Management: Tools for tracking stock levels and managing suppliers. User Management: Ability to manage user accounts and feedback. Delivery Partner Features: Notifications: Alerts for new delivery assignments. Route Optimization: Efficient routing for timely deliveries. 3. Choose the Right Technology Stack Frontend: React or Vue.js for a responsive and dynamic UI. Backend: Node.js with Express.js for handling server-side logic. Database: MongoDB or PostgreSQL for data management. Payment Gateway: Integrate Stripe, PayPal, or similar for secure transactions. 4. Create a User-Centric Design Wireframes: Sketch the layout for each app screen. Prototypes: Develop clickable prototypes to visualize user flows. UI/UX Design: Focus on a clean, intuitive interface with accessible navigation. 5. Development Process Agile Methodology: Use Agile practices to allow flexibility and iterative improvements. Backend Development: Set up the server, APIs, and database schemas. Frontend Development: Build the user interface, ensuring responsiveness across devices. Integration: Connect frontend and backend using RESTful APIs. 6. Testing Automated Testing: Implement unit and integration tests to ensure code quality. User Acceptance Testing (UAT): Gather feedback from real users to identify areas for improvement. Bug Fixing: Address any issues discovered during testing. 7. Deployment Choose a Hosting Service: Options like AWS, Heroku, or DigitalOcean for hosting. Continuous Integration/Continuous Deployment (CI/CD): Automate deployment processes for quick updates. 8. Launch Strategy Marketing Plan: Develop a strategy that includes social media campaigns, SEO, and partnerships with local pharmacies. User Onboarding: Create tutorials or guides to help new users navigate the app. 9. Post-Launch Support and Maintenance Monitor Performance: Use analytics tools to track user engagement and app performance. Regular Updates: Continuously improve the app based on user feedback and market trends. Customer Support: Implement a support system to address user inquiries and issues.
